:wave: Newbie here with a couple of questions..

When I add chemicals (BL, MA) should the Polaris be out of the water?

How many hours a day do you normally run the Polaris?

The run time, is all at once, or periodically thruout the day?

My PB set mine up on the Easytouch8.. it comes on by itself and goes off. (That's a whole new set of questions, but not on this thread..) lol.

Thank you in advance!

(It's doing a great job, as far as I can tell..)
 
You shouldn't have to run it more than a couple of hours a day, maybe less. Your experience will tell you what is sufficient. Minimal run times will save energy and wear and tear.

They are pretty well made and fairly chemical resistant. That said they will fade eventually, and excessive chemical exposure can damage the bearings.
